Transaction 954eb8648800596bcef1bea273c0dc2fd0592ed9d93cb76622bbd9ae271c09c9

73 Input
2 Outputs
  • 954eb8648800596bcef1bea273c0dc2fd0592ed9d93cb76622bbd9ae271c09c9:0
  • value  63995290
    address  124yHvBz8zwPn1YYJ1RtvpgeqmkSEm9reR
  • 954eb8648800596bcef1bea273c0dc2fd0592ed9d93cb76622bbd9ae271c09c9:1
  • value  2267281
    address  3KYvft4oK6TWK52wUDGTMMKyqegD7C9RtW